THE IMPACT YOU CAN HAVE

The Risk Management Analyst supports the organization’s workers’ compensation, general liability, and Captive Insurance programs by analyzing loss data, monitoring claim performance, and collaborating with internal teams and third-party administrators to reduce the total cost of risk. This role is crucial in translating complex claims and actuarial data into actionable insights for leadership, ensuring alignment with retail and distribution operations, legal strategy, and financial goals. Additionally, the Risk Management Analyst will assist with insurance procurement and administration, as well as risk management financial budgeting, tracking, and reporting to support effective decision-making across the organization.

YOU'LL ACCOMPLISH THESE GOALS BY
  • Analyze workers’ compensation and general liability claims data to identify loss drivers, trends, and emerging risks across retail and distribution locations.
  • Monitor claim severity, frequency, litigated claim ratios, and reserve adequacy; elevate concerns and recommend corrective actions as necessary.
  • Prepare loss summaries, dashboards, and executive-level reports for risk, finance, legal, and operations leadership.
  • Support the management of the casualty insurance program, including deductible, self-insured retention, and captive structures.
  • Support the procurement and administration of insurance policies by coordinating with brokers, underwriters, and internal stakeholders to gather necessary data, complete applications, and maintain accurate policy records.
  • Lead risk management financial budgeting, tracking, and reporting, ensuring costs are accurately projected, monitored, and communicated to leadership for effective decision-making.
  • Track total cost of risk metrics, pure loss rates, and key performance indicators in comparison to retail peers and industry benchmarks.
  • Partner with actuarial, finance, and brokerage teams during renewals, forecasts, and budget planning processes.
  • Collaborate with in-house claims team, third-party administrators (TPAs), insurance carriers, and defense counsel to ensure timely reporting, effective claim handling, and adherence to best practices.
  • Review TPA performance metrics, including three-point contact, early investigation, litigation management, and closure rates.
  • Support initiatives aimed at reducing attorney involvement through early intervention, mediation, and employee engagement strategies.
  • Work closely with Legal, People Success, Safety/EH&S, and Store Operations teams to improve incident timely reporting, claim outcomes, and return-to-work results.
  • Assist in developing training materials and guidance for field leadership on incident reporting and claims awareness.
  • Provide data-driven insights to inform policy decisions, safety initiatives, and risk mitigation strategies.
  • Ensure accurate documentation and data integrity across claims systems, insurance platforms, and internal reporting tools.
  • Assist with audits, carrier data calls, and regulatory reporting as needed.
